FARACIANO v. MILLER BREWING CO.

No. 82-C-1297.

582 F.Supp. 1262 (1984)

Peter A. FARACIANO, Plaintiff, v. MILLER BREWING COMPANY, a Wisconsin corporation, and Brewery Workers Local Union No. 9, Directly Affiliated Local Union, AFL-CIO, Defendants.

United States District Court, E.D. Wisconsin.

March 19,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Walter F. Kelly, Sutton & Kelly, Milwaukee, Wis., for plaintiff.

Ely A. Leichtling, Quarles & Brady, Milwaukee, Wis., for Miller Brewing.

James P. Maloney, Zubrensky, Padden, Graf & Maloney, Milwaukee, Wis., for Union.


DECISION AND ORDER

WARREN, District Judge.

This case comes before the Court on motions for summary judgment made by the defendants Miller Brewing Company ("Miller") and Brewery Workers Local No. 9 ("the Union"), pursuant to Rule 56 of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ure. For the reasons stated herein, the Court grants defendants' motions and accordingly dismisses the action brought by the plaintiff, Peter A. Faraciano.
